India’s cricket board has said that Mahendra Singh Dhoni's job as limited-overs captain is safe despite the team's third successive one-day series defeat. That’s according to BCCI secretary Anurag Thakur, who says Dhoni is still the right man to lead India in the shorter version of the game. India lost the third ODI to Australia on Sunday to crash to yet another series defeat.
